Every syllable of his full name crashed down on Stingray like the swing of a hammer. He felt himself crouching lower and lower with every strike of Meerkat's voice, and when ma indicated that he was to stay right next to her, he scurried obediently into place. Mr. Bubbles was conspicuously absent now. Of course he was. He loved getting Stingray into trouble and then disappearing, and Ray was too young to see the red flags in such a friendship.

He peered up at Bronco while Meerkat introduced him. Uncle Bronco was as scarred as scarred could be, almost rivalling Rosalyn. Maybe even topping Rosalyn. Stingray thought scars were pretty cool, so his first impression of his uncle was that he was a badass. But then Bronco started making fun of his name.

His second impression of his uncle was that he was a jackass.

Ray pulled a face when Bronco called him stinkray. He was already feeling a little down and self-conscious on account of being caught red-handed sneaking away from the rendezvous site and knowing he was gonna be in trouble later, so having his name made fun of certainly didn't help. Maybe on another day, he'd have taken it for the joke it was. Today, it just hit wrong. It didn't help that Mr. Bubbles had appeared again in the trees and was laughing at him.

He turned to sniff at his own shoulder, then looked down at his toes, saying nothing in response.
